#5c0423 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5c0423 is composed of 36.1% red, 1.6%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 95.7% magenta, 62% yellow and 63.9% black. It has a hue angle of 338.9 degrees, a saturation of 91.7% and a lightness of 18.8%. #5c0423 color hex could be obtained by blending #b80846 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

Shades and Tints of #5c0423

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110106 is the darkest color, while #fffd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#5c0423

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#332d2f is the less saturated color, while #600022 is the most saturated one.
